Taman Lagenda Mas in Hulu Langat, Selangor recorded 21 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M 475K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 350.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 475K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 130K to RM 986K, and a typical market range of RM 420K to RM 530K.

Most transactions involved town house, with moderate diversity in property types available.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M 350, though individual units vary from RM 261 to RM 439 in the core range. The broader market spans RM 302.41 to RM 397.66,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M 95.25) and deviation (MAD: RM 89)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
